Acts 2:45 Meaning and Commentary

Acts 2:45

And sold their possessions and goods.
&c.] Their houses and lands, their fields and vineyards, their goods, moveable or immoveable:

and parted them to all men;
that were of their society, not to others:

as every man had need:
the rich sold their estates, and divided them among the poor, or gave them such a portion thereof as their present exigencies required. This was done by Jews, and by Jews only; who, when they embraced the Gospel of Christ, were informed that the destruction of their city, and nation, was at hand; and therefore they sold their estates before hand, and put them to this use; which was necessary to be done, both for the support of the Gospel in Judea, and for the carrying and spreading of it among the Gentiles: but is not to be drawn into a precedent, or an example in after times; nor is ever any such thing proposed to the Christian churches, or exhorted to by any of the apostles.
